CINEMA SCREENINGS.
NOTES SUPPLIED BY THE THEATRES
Clara Bow, most emotional of sereus atars, has never been pictured in an entirely emotional role. Many times married in her screen charac terizations, ale has never been shown an a mother.
Yet in "Call Her Savage," her initial Fox picture now playing at the King's Theatre, she discards the flapperisms that made for famous, portrays a tensely-dramatic role and depicts the rich emotionallam of mother love.
"Call Her Savage" was adapted by Edwin Burke from Tiffany Thayer's much-discussed novel, and was direct; ed by John Francis Dillon,

"Red Dust"
One of the most anticipated pre- | ductions of the new season comes to the Queen's Theatre on Sunday with the co-starring appearance of Clark Cable
Harlow in and Jean Dust.."
"Red
with The locale is Cochin-China, Gable playing a hardened plantation foreman who has. Lorced himself to become completely brutalized in an effort to remain superior to his en- vironment of fever, tropical hent and teacherous natives.
To Miss Harlow falls the role of Vantine, born to the tropics, hard- home on the boiled. perfectly at Flantation and equal in strength and antinal pugnacity to the men. It in when the beautiful wife of an en- gineer comes to the plantation and is involved in a love affair with Gable that the jealous and fiery nature of this savage-like creature asserts it- self and brings the netion of the plot to a dramatically compromising situn- tion.
CHINESE IGNORED.
FRENCH DEMOLISH TIENTSIN
NAVAL HOSPITAL
Nanking May 18. Admiral Chen Sbao-kuan, Minis- ter of Navy, told press represen Intives to-day that the French Authorities have not only ignored the Chinese protest regarding the sale of the Chinese naval hospital in the French Concession in Tien- tsin. but a greater part of the building has already been pulled
down.
Admiral Chen reiterated that the sale by Marshal Chang Houch- lang was legal and that the
Government would continue pro- testing to the French Authorities. -Reuter.
